Beauty From The Earth Cosmetics

Well a few months ago I came across this page on Facebook for a make-up company called Beauty from the Earth Cosmetics. They really caught my eye because of their extensive line of eye shadows and uniqueness of colors. As I started browsing their selection, I began to get that overwhelmed feeling again.

Then I discovered… sample sizes. For only $2, you can choose a color in a sample size jar. This was perfect for me! I suddenly found it easier to pick out colors. I figured if I didn’t like it, I’m sure I could find someone who did. You cannot go wrong for $2. There is nothing worse than buying eye shadow and then realizing you don’t like the color. Granted, there are stores who will allow you to return make-up, but who feels like making trip after trip to the store until you get the right color. Or what about when you buy an eye shadow set and there are one or two colors in the set you don’t like. It seems like such a waste.

I made the bold move and for $18, purchased 7 sample size eye shadows: Lollipop Kid, Black, Mania, Olive You, Bewitched, Bermuda, and Livid. Did I mention they have really fun names for their shades? Let me just say, I was so impressed with the company and their products. First off, the shipping was reasonably quick and the customer service is right on top of things. Although the sample size jar seems small, it actually goes a long way. You can get at least 10 uses out of it before running out. Also, if you are like me and skeptical about ordering online in fear that the color won’t look like the picture from the website, never fear. Their colors are dead on and for an extra bonus, they are incredibly sparkly. After trying out their shades, if you really like them you can purchase a full size jar for only $6.50.

The eye shadows do come as a loose powder. However, you can buy Mix & Fix to turn them from a powder to a smooth wet eye shadow. They also carry other make-ups, sets, collections, accessories… too much to mention in one review. You need to browse the site and see (and buy) for yourself.
